Adrian's McGaw, Albion's Blanzy Earn D3football.com National Team of the Week Honors

Two Michigan Intercollegiate Athletic Association football players were honored nationally Monday for efforts on the field last weekend, as Adrian's Jerron McGaw and Albion's Brian Blanzy were named to the D3football.com's National Team of the Week. It marked the second consecutive week an Albion player garnered national honors from the online publication.

McGaw, who was also named the MIAA Offensive Player of the Week on Monday, tied a school record with five TD receptions (15, 4, 39, 65, 6) while establishing career bests of 13 catches and 256 yards in Adrian's 56-27 win over Buffalo State Sept. 8. His 256 receiving yards are nine shy of the Adrian single-game mark.

Blanzy caught seven passes for a career-high 119 receiving yards, scoring two touchdowns in a 56-35 Albion win vs. Franklin Sept. 8. Albion is currently receiving votes in the latest D3football.com Top 25 poll thanks to a 2-0 start to the season.
